Brazil - Import of Fresh Apricots
Since 2014, Brazil Import of Fresh Apricots was down by 10.2% year on year. In 2019, the country was ranked number 59 comparing other countries in Import of Fresh Apricots with $272,403. Brazil is overtaken by Malta, which was number 58 at $276,803.31 and is followed by Moldova at $120,752. Germany topped the ranking with $113,136,454.47 in 2019, an increase of 1.5% compared to 2018. Russia, France and Kazakhstan resp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Azerbaijan witnessed the best average annual growth at +617.3% per year, while New Zealand was the worst growing country at -78.3% per year.
